Why Godsmack chose “Bulletproof” as Lead Single for new Album

 Godsmack frontman Sully Erna was recently asked by WDHA-FM on why the band chose “Bulletproof” as the lead single of their latest studio album “When Legends Rise.” Here’s what he had to say about the song choice.

“It just felt like the right song. It seemed to have every element of the song that shapes a hit song to be a hit song – something that truly resonates with people and is memorable.

“And it was just one of those choruses that I felt was a bit undeniable – you heard it once and you get it, it’s a no-brainer and you’re singing it for the rest of the day. And when a song speaks to me that way, I feel the right move is to release that.

“And not only that – but it had a little bit more of a melodic factor to it. It wasn’t that typical really gritty, tough, edgy song that Godsmack’s used to delivering for the first single.

“We wanted to open up some new doors, so we felt like maybe we kick the door open with this one and then we’ll figure out how to walk through it.”
